The Team

 

The long-term vision of TRI’s Accelerated Materials Design and Discovery (AMDD) program is to accelerate the development of truly emissions-free mobility. Realizing this vision will require the discovery of new materials and devices for batteries, fuel cells, and more. Our aim at TRI is to merge cutting-edge computational materials modeling, experimental data, artificial intelligence, and automation to significantly accelerate materials research. Our focus is on developing tools and capabilities to enable this acceleration. We collaborate closely with a dozen universities and national labs and colleagues across global Toyota. AMDD seeks to develop and translate the newest technologies into practice, both within Toyota and the open research community more broadly.

 

The Internship

 

This project aims to develop methodologies for AI agents to interact with scientific workflows, towards the end of improving collaboration with users. This project may include studying and improving agentic capacity to plan, design, and execute complex tasks within scientific and engineering domains. The intern will prove out the practical application of these systems, with the goal of producing and developing adaptable frameworks and advancing our understanding of agentic AI's contribution to scientific exploration and automation.

 

This is a Summer 2026 paid 12-week internship opportunity. Please note that this internship will be an in-office role.
